Abstract

Corn (Zea mays subsp. mays L.) is one of the most important carbohydrateproducing food crops in the world, apart from wheat and rice. However, the productivity of sweet corn in Indonesia has decreased from 2018 to 2021. This is caused by nutrient deficiencies, pests, and diseases, as well as drought stress. To overcome these problems, they need to be overcome by using mycorrhiza and spacing. The purpose of this study was to determine the effect of mycorrhizal applications and variations in spacing, as well as their interactions, on the growth and production of sweet corn (Zea mays subsp. mays L.). The experimental design used in this study was a randomized block design (RBD) consisting of 2 factors, namely the mycorrhizal dose as factor 1, consisting of 3 levels: M1: 0 gram/plant, M2: 15 gram/plant, and M3: 30 gram/plant. Factor 2 was the variation in plant spacing, consisting of 3 levels: J1: 70 cm × 20 cm, J2: 70 cm × 30 cm, and J3: 70 cm × 40 cm. The results showed that mycorrhizal treatment with a dose of 30 grams per plant (M3) showed the best results on the growth of the number of leaves of the plant, as much as 9.97 leaves. Spacing showed the best results for the growth and yield of corn plants. Especially on plant height (159.16cm) and cob weight (311.05 gram). There was an interaction between mycorrhiza at a dose of 15 grams per plant (M2) and a spacing of 70 cm × 20 cm (J1) on yield. The average interaction of these treatments resulted in an average yield of 9.000 kg/ha.

Additional Information: Tanaman jagung (Zea mays L.) merupakan salah satu tanaman pangan pengahasil karbohidrat yang terpenting di dunia, selain gandum dan juga padi. Namun produktivitas jagung manis di Indonesia mengalami penurunan dari tahun 2018-2021. Hal ini disebabkan oleh oleh kekurangan unsur hara, hama dan penyakit, serta cekaman kekeringan. Untuk mengatasi masalah tersebut perlu diatasi dengan menggunakan mikoriza dan pengaturan jarak tanam. Tujuan dari penelitian ini adalah untuk mengetahui pengaruh aplikasi mikoriza dan variasi jarak tanam, serta interaksinya terhadap pertumbuhan dan produksi jagung manis (Zea mays subsp. mays L.). Rancangan percobaan yang digunakan pada penelitian ini adalah Rancangan Acak Kelompok (RAK) terdiri dari 2 faktor, yaitu dosis mikoriza sebagai faktor 1, terdiri dari 3 taraf, M1: 0 gram/tanaman, M2: 15 gram/tanaman, dan M3: 30 gram/tanaman. Faktor 2 adalah variasi jarak tanam, terdiri dari 3 taraf, J1: 70 cm × 20 cm, J2: 70 cm × 30 cm, dan J3: 70 cm × 40 cm. Hasil penelitian menunjukkan bahwa perlakuan mikoriza dengan dosis 30 gram per tanaman (M3) memberikan hasil terbaik pada pertumbuhan jumlah daun tanaman sebanyak 9,97 helai daun. Jarak tanam memberikan hasil terbaik pada pertumbuhan dan hasil tanaman jagung. Terutama pada tinggi tanaman (159,16), dan bobot tongkol berkelobot (311, 05). Terdapat interaksi antara mikoriza dosis 15 gram per tanaman (M2) dan jarak tanam 70 cm × 20 cm (J1) terhadap daya hasil. Rata-rata interaksi perlakuan tersebut menghasilkan rata-rata daya hasil tanaman yaitu 9000 kg/ha.
